36 Commits

Author SHA1 Message Date
starlord
476d21927b MS-245 Improve search result transfer performance
Former-commit-id: 77ce402c5ab2c851afa11cb2d637acb69d9ad737
2019-07-17 17:37:42 +08:00
peng.xu
710ae19ded feat(server): add build index api
Former-commit-id: f11ab6f56784e490bbe34818d05c700c78cad118
2019-07-09 19:53:39 +08:00
jinhai
58969d48a8 Merge branch 'branch-0.3.1' of http://192.168.1.105:6060/megasearch/vecwise_engine into branch-0.3.1
Former-commit-id: d456d64d94d7eba0f6d9784ff6b92c24f510f0d6
2019-06-30 13:02:46 +08:00
jinhai
fbae790c1b MS-133 Change score to distance
Former-commit-id: 6cb53e9fe988a17c293aa9faee663d5d48c98fc9
2019-06-30 13:02:42 +08:00
groot
8622b12aa6 MS-126 Add more error code
Former-commit-id: ab57dcf1a8449e9cf2fc6440b308647f4d866777
2019-06-27 18:03:52 +08:00
groot
eb76842114 MS-124 HasTable interface
Former-commit-id: 1f15f5d8bfbafbcbc3bfc0f3d9ee129150fd5186
2019-06-27 15:51:25 +08:00
groot
b0471a7e53 add new query interface for specified files
Former-commit-id: 5679e6c73f5475b04ce6db79de197cfd5d3e5499
2019-06-19 10:53:46 +08:00
groot
d031bb9e26 remove old names from source code
Former-commit-id: 3fcd7e5e6d2a8d147f09aa455c4a3f3eab20a24a
2019-06-14 17:29:29 +08:00
groot
ff7cab7006 refacture db code
Former-commit-id: d232155b1de07bd7b66a64f39417f25118b59891
2019-06-09 15:45:43 +08:00
groot
f681c3ae86 restruct thrift package
Former-commit-id: d02f846e4ffa3c61d860b081054d4526e03eb930
2019-05-30 10:02:17 +08:00
groot
168ac46cdb fix thrift generate error
Former-commit-id: 444233484091fe329e190a5fd62bf93c5e26e3f4
2019-05-30 09:24:14 +08:00
groot
4b244f9d45 redefine thrift api
Former-commit-id: 8d7d1c47202341521cf06a567e8f7cf3cfc55074
2019-05-27 19:57:09 +08:00
groot
d14b718862 change api namespace
Former-commit-id: ad513035c3db217c61e0eddcfaa633237564311c
2019-05-14 15:29:37 +08:00
groot
678f1010a1 use rocksdb column family
Former-commit-id: dbf59149386a71807ff3ea4498240afd102b5001
2019-05-14 11:16:18 +08:00
groot
a56333b55d throw exception
Former-commit-id: 6a8ae6f0c0b73fc9411b039143a1650e6ab7cc02
2019-05-13 17:05:24 +08:00
groot
b2d988b9c6 fix bug
Former-commit-id: 53fa5d480d001cc82145710fa0329604b85bab19
2019-05-10 14:32:43 +08:00
groot
7e6b928ce8 modify thrift api
Former-commit-id: 6a9222b918447562add54efb852bb8716c5ed254
2019-05-10 10:39:59 +08:00
groot
f9967cd744 modify thrift api
Former-commit-id: 744dec10d157280d9776a7507aaa428ca76aad66
2019-05-10 10:39:21 +08:00
groot
6a27275486 regen thrift py
Former-commit-id: a199ad849e1a0a6534bd343deaf8e4aa6a1335d5
2019-05-09 19:16:40 +08:00
groot
b97b406ce6 regen thrift cpp
Former-commit-id: 2d37cc786425da956db94fc2f3f5de824ad54b94
2019-05-09 19:16:13 +08:00
groot
faa2c4b4b1 support empty id
Former-commit-id: 1a5303b58f3f3b0154f1609ff1acc0d00007c569
2019-05-05 20:13:34 +08:00
groot
905722bd0e add python sample
Former-commit-id: 2c0825ad6ed774eb5ad1999b1439f840dc602bf1
2019-04-30 14:47:36 +08:00
groot
aa591114c4 time range search
Former-commit-id: 182c5c9db2d3aeaafc4d4878f060435c442b366c
2019-04-30 11:18:08 +08:00
groot
363de87bdb gen python api
Former-commit-id: 1c9b4a1fea7c450b55e8d683085d8779460ea3c4
2019-04-29 17:58:08 +08:00
groot
231b216963 add namespace for thrift api
Former-commit-id: 92f9e0a0f7d2e301120573976984f99062b8f44e
2019-04-29 17:55:50 +08:00
groot
592dde4dd7 add attribute for vector
Former-commit-id: c2a1a5cd917abe1cf3e8ef327bba5c2ed1cf8008
2019-04-29 16:12:35 +08:00
groot
487ea03461 redefine thrift api
Former-commit-id: 0dc225d0372e6e2260126a301552a37d161ccec8
2019-04-29 11:01:01 +08:00
groot
13d7ebb5cf add new api for batch binary search
Former-commit-id: 3729408c50d0ab9a482e3ddea8e1672188a9acd8
2019-04-28 12:07:15 +08:00
groot
a5682c301f add new api for binary vector
Former-commit-id: 0c37b1fa7ab1a3da301da0371ae275f0a118931f
2019-04-26 20:57:06 +08:00
groot
3815528396 modify thrift api
Former-commit-id: 9516c969a09e06c073e02b1186503776df2f370a
2019-04-24 17:34:21 +08:00
groot
e7075c185d modify server api
Former-commit-id: 3eff45989dd09bf7b7aae8b2a004f83898708dd6
2019-04-22 13:56:38 +08:00
groot
3224c4eb70 client call api
Former-commit-id: f2d5ccecb8359642ba8d63ef538b90fba209b2b5
2019-04-18 10:50:24 +08:00
groot
e568941180 refine code
Former-commit-id: 4406ca272f134594421b89aa34b6f91a3d8a92a4
2019-04-18 10:48:56 +08:00
groot
719c232528 modify test client
Former-commit-id: d9bd14f32c078b87bdb58e46efe6e45912a5baef
2019-04-18 10:48:56 +08:00
groot
836bfb5c07 build debug thrift
Former-commit-id: 252bae2826946ae61a1a2ada570844b413f3df02
2019-04-18 10:48:56 +08:00
groot
2a850821b5 add test client
Former-commit-id: af73a98aad00251fa5432d39e092ee950fe2db2b
2019-04-18 10:48:56 +08:00